West Africa Mining Site – Primary Power Supply for Gold Extraction Operations

Project Background

In a remote gold mining region of West Africa, a major extraction company needed to establish a reliable primary power system capable of running continuously in harsh environmental conditions. With no national power grid access within 150 kilometers, the entire operation — from rock crushing and grinding mills to conveyor systems and ventilation fans — depended entirely on on-site power generation.

The challenge was significant: ambient temperatures regularly exceeded 40°C, dust levels were extreme, and the site operated around the clock. Any power interruption could halt production, leading to substantial financial losses and potential safety hazards for underground workers.

The Challenge

  • Location: Remote mining site, 150km from nearest grid connection
  • Climate: Extreme heat (40°C+), high dust, seasonal heavy rains
  • Load requirement: 2,500 kVA continuous prime power
  • Operation mode: 24/7 continuous operation, 365 days per year
  • Fuel logistics: Diesel delivery only possible during dry season via unpaved roads

Our Solution

After a thorough assessment of the site conditions and power requirements, MechVolt Power designed and delivered a multi-unit parallel power system:

  • Primary units: 3 × 1000 kVA Cummins-powered diesel generators in soundproof canopies, configured for parallel operation with automatic load sharing
  • Backup unit: 1 × 800 kVA standby generator for N+1 redundancy
  • Control system: Advanced ATS (Automatic Transfer Switch) with intelligent load management, capable of starting backup units within 10 seconds if any primary unit fails
  • Fuel storage: Double-walled bulk fuel tank with 50,000-liter capacity, sufficient for 7 days of continuous operation at full load
  • Cooling system: Heavy-duty radiator systems with oversized cores designed for 50°C ambient temperature operation

Key Equipment Specifications

ParameterSpecification
Generator ModelMechVolt MV-C1000
Prime Power Output3 × 1000 kVA (parallel)
Standby Backup1 × 800 kVA
Engine BrandCummins QST30-G5
Alternator BrandStamford PI734
Canopy TypeHeavy-duty soundproof (75 dBA @ 7m)
Fuel Tank Capacity50,000 liters (7-day reserve)
Control SystemDeep Sea DSE8610 with parallel module

Results

The power system has been operating reliably for over 18 months since commissioning, with an uptime exceeding 99.5%. The parallel configuration allows for flexible power output adjustment based on production schedules, and the N+1 redundancy ensures that maintenance can be performed on individual units without interrupting operations.

Fuel consumption has been optimized through intelligent load management, achieving a 12% reduction compared to the client’s initial estimates. The robust cooling and air filtration systems have performed well in the dusty, high-temperature environment with minimal maintenance issues.
